Strike hits banking operations

New Delhi, Jan 4: Banking services through out the country on Friday were affected during a day-long strike by employees against alleged forcible transfers in Standard Chartered Bank (SCB), leading to hold up in bank clearance worth more than Rs 400 crore.

The SCB management while refusing any comment on the strike called by All India Bank Employees Association (AIBEA) said it had the right to carry out its functions. In Mumbai, the country’s commercial hub, clearing house operations at the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) were partially affected owing to the strike.

"Clearing house operations were partially affected as six banks, including SCB, did not participate," a RBI spokesperson said.
